The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Mr Pedder, born in 1808 in Isleworth, Middlesex, consisted of 3 members. Mr was the head of the household, married to Mrs Pedder, born in 1824 in Ratcliff, Middlesex,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Mr's Grandchild, Ernest Damill, born in 1874 in Mile End, Middlesex, England.
